Pre-Distortion Method for Intra-channel Nonlinearity Compensation with Phase-rotated Perturbation Term

Abstract

With proper phase rotation on perturbation terms, the enhanced intra-channel nonlinearity pre-distortion was proposed and demonstrated. The experiment shows that 1dB improvement is achieved and the performance is even better than back-propagation for RZ format.
